The POZ2AN-1-204N-T00 is a thermistor manufactured by Murata Electronics North America. This thermistor is designed for temperature sensing, control, and compensation in various electronic applications. It is a negative temperature coefficient (NTC) thermistor, meaning its resistance decreases as its temperature increases.

Additional Details
The POZ2AN-1-204N-T00 thermistor has a nominal resistance of 200 kOhms at 25°C. It is characterized by its B-constant, which determines the relationship between temperature and resistance. The 'T00' designation typically indicates a specific packaging or lead configuration. This thermistor is well-suited for applications where accurate temperature sensing and compensation are required. Its small size and leaded design allow for easy integration into a variety of electronic circuits. Proper use requires consideration of the thermistor's power dissipation constant to minimize self-heating effects. It is crucial to refer to the Murata Electronics North America datasheet for precise specifications.
For optimal performance, the thermistor should be operated within its specified temperature range, and its power dissipation should be minimized to avoid self-heating effects, which can lead to inaccurate readings.
